This new collaboration includes five colorways made from all-natural dyes that have been ethically harvested. The shoes are prepared in tannins, and then slowly treated in special dyes extracted from plants with “skin-soothing medicinal properties.”

Each is a reflection of Stüssy’s five world tour cities:
New York – the violet colorway, is made using Brazilwood, Quebracho Rojo and Hibiscus, to mention a few ingredients
Los Angeles – Weld, Fustic, Osage Orange and Turmeric
Tokyo – Organic Indigofera Tinctoria
London – Organic Indigofera Tinctoria, Fustic, and Weld
Paris – Chestnut Bark, Myrobalan and Iron.
Stüssy emphasizes that each pair is carefully hand-dyed by Lookout & Wonderland in Los Angeles, California, “an art practice based in plant color, medicine and fiber.”
